Why it’s important to have 1000 lb cattle in March mud month. With the lighter weight 1000 lb cows and hitting March mud month, our pastures are not destroyed as long as we keep moving them onto new pasture. It takes observation and predicting areas that you may muck up if it rains heavily that day. Just make sure that you do not have narrow confined areas that they can get bunched up in. This tight cow mob bunching can turn a pasture into mud quite quickly if you don't move them.
